Abstract
Abstract We study a mechanism design problem where arbitrary restrictions are placed on the sets of first-order beliefs of agents. Calling these restrictions Δ, we use Δ-rationalizability (Battigalli and Siniscalchi, 2003, [5] ) as our solution concept, and require that a mechanism virtually implement a socially desirable outcome. We obtain two necessary conditions, Δ-incentive compatibility and Δ-measurability and show that the latter is satisfied as long as a particular zero-measure set of first-order beliefs is ruled out. In environments allowing small transfers of utility among agents, these two conditions are also sufficient.
